The Danger of Unmanaged IGMP Leaks: How IPTV Can Crash Older Routers

The pattern that keeps showing up across modern smart home networks is that unmanaged multicast video streams can quietly cripple legacy residential router hubs. Most network security engineers find that when a streaming media player requests a live multicast feed, a basic, unmanaged router will treat those video packets like a broadcast emergency, flooding every single port on the network.


Your streaming stick plays the channel perfectly, but suddenly your home security cameras drop offline, your smart thermostats disconnect, and your local router completely freezes up and reboots itself. It is a highly frustrating hardware failure caused by unmanaged data flooding. What is happening under the hood is that your older router's tiny internal processor is completely drowning in multicast data traffic, running out of memory as it tries to process unwanted video packets across unrelated devices.


To shield your home network hardware from this data overload completely, pairing an advanced IPTV subscription with a network router that supports Internet Group Management Protocol (IGMP) Snooping is the professional remedy. This smart network protocol instructs your router to listen to device requests and map the live video feed strictly to the specific ethernet port holding your media player.


Here’s the thing: leaving your home network to broadcast live video packets blindly across your entire smart home ecosystem is an open invitation for hardware instability.


With an active IGMP snooping layout managing your traffic lanes, your IPTV subscription client handles high-bitrate data pipelines in complete isolation, leaving your other smart devices free to run without network pollution. What actually works is accessing your router's advanced lan configuration screen and turning on the setting labeled "IGMP Snooping Status."
